随着移动互联网的快速发展,小程序作为一种轻量级的应用形式,越来越受到用户的喜爱。小程序的性能和加载速度往往成为用户评价的关键因素。本文将分享一些优化小程序性能与加载速度的方法,帮助开发者提升用户体验。
一、优化代码
1. 压缩代码:使用工具如UglifyJS、Terser等对JavaScript代码进行压缩,减少文件体积。
2. 减少HTTP请求:合并CSS、JavaScript等静态资源,减少HTTP请求次数,降低加载时间。
3. 优化图片:使用图片压缩工具,如TinyPNG、ImageOptim等,减小图片体积,提高加载速度。
4. 使用CDN:将静态资源部署到CDN,加快资源加载速度。
二、优化资源加载
1. 异步加载:使用异步加载技术,如异步JavaScript(async)、动态加载(Dynamic Imports)等,实现资源的按需加载。
2. 预加载:通过预加载技术,如预加载关键资源、预加载懒加载资源等,提高首屏加载速度。
3. 图片懒加载:对于非首屏显示的图片,采用懒加载技术,减少初次加载的数据量。
4. 缓存策略:合理设置缓存策略,如HTTP缓存头、Service Worker等,提高资源加载效率。
三、优化页面布局
1. 减少DOM元素:精简页面DOM结构,减少渲染时间。
2. 使用CSS3动画:尽量使用CSS3动画代替JavaScript动画,减少JavaScript执行时间。
3. 优化CSS选择器:简化CSS选择器,提高CSS渲染效率。
4. 使用响应式设计:适配不同屏幕尺寸,提高页面加载速度。
四、监控与优化
1. 使用性能监控工具:如Chrome DevTools、Fiddler等,实时监控小程序性能,找出性能瓶颈。
2. 定期进行性能优化:根据监控数据,定期对小程序进行性能优化。
3. 用户体验测试:邀请用户进行用户体验测试,收集反馈,持续优化小程序性能。
优化小程序的性能与加载速度,是提升用户体验的关键。通过以上方法,开发者可以从代码、资源加载、页面布局等方面入手,全面优化小程序性能。定期进行性能监控与优化,确保小程序始终保持良好的运行状态。
合肥万江荣富专业定制开发小程序,模板齐全,功能实现成本低,常用小程序开发的成本很低,欢迎合肥本地朋友合作!
- 2025
03-06 - 小程序开发助力各行业盈利,五大高效策略分享 小程序开发助力各行业盈利的有效途径随着移动互联网的快速发展,小程序作为一种轻量级的应用程序,逐渐成为企业拓展市场、提升品牌影响力的重要工具。本文将探讨小程序开发如何助力各行业实现盈...
- 2025
02-15 - 健康医疗小程序:开启便捷健康生活新时代 健康医疗领域在不断创新以适应人们日益增长的健康需求。健康医疗小程序的出现,为人们提供了一种全新的健康管理方式,比如利用小程序结合AI来诊断一些特征,再整合了预约挂号、在线咨询、健康...